Objective: To investigate the relationship between ALDH1highCD44+CD24-/low breast cancerstem cells from pleural fluids or peripheral blood of breast cancer patients and clinicalsignificance.Methods:(1)sample①.single cells of MCF-7 cell line.②.collect 58 blood samples from 12volunteers and 46 breast cancer patients.③.collect 10 pleural fluids samples from breastcancer patients.(2)method The human MCF-7 cells is used as a model to develop a suspension arrayassay for the detection of markers expression for human breast cancer stem cells ,then oursuspension array is used to examine the markers expression for the cells from peripheralblood or pleural fluids of breast cancer patients.(3)content investigate the relationship between ALDH1highCD44+CD24-/low cells fromperipheral blood or pleural fluids of breast cancer patients and clinical significance,diagnosisvalue.Results:(1) The expressions of ALDH1highcells in the direct analysis group after ALDH1 reactionand the further labeled antibody group were(67.5±1.3)%and(66.1±1.5)%,respectively.There is no significant difference between 2 groups(P>0.05);The expressionof CD44+CD24-/lowwere(9.1±1.6)% in the direct labeling antibody group and(8.9±1.1)%in the ALDH1+antibody group,respectively.There is no significant difference between 2groups(P>0.05) .(2) The proportion of ALDH1highCD44+CD24-/low cells of volunteers ,Ⅰphrase,Ⅱphrase,Ⅲphrase,Ⅳphrase breast cancer patients are 0.00%,0.00%0.04%,0.00%0.13%, 0.00%1.45%,0.19%6.80%,respectively; The content of ALDH1highCD44+CD24-/low cellshave statistical significance betweenⅣphrase breast cancer patients'with all otherteams(P<0.05); All other teams are no statistical significance among them(P>0.05).(3)Among the ten cases of breast cancer patients'pleural fluids,the proportion ofALDH1highCD44+CD24-/low cells is between 0.14% to 6.80%,and the mean average is 2.56%.There is no statistical significance between ALDH1highCD44+CD24-/low cells proportion withER or HER-2 status(P>0.05).Conclusions:(1) We successfully develop a suspension assay for the detection of markers expression forhuman breast cancer stem cells.The detection results of ALDH1highCD44+CD24-/lowcells could not be impacted by further labeling antibody after ALDH1 reaction,and thedetection results of further labeled antibody also could not be impacted by ALDH1reaction.(2) The 11 samples of theⅣphrase breast cancer patients'peripheral blood are all detectedthe aim cells,and 4 of them form groups in the FCM pictures.The detection ofALDH1highCD44+CD24-/low cells in breast cancer patients'peripheral blood might beuseful tool for diagnosising and evaluating the curative effect.(3) ALDH1highCD44+CD24-/low cells might be the common breast cancer stem cells of all thebreast cancer gene subtypes.
